argo为什么没有服务器
-
Argo没有服务器是因为它是一种完全分散式的网络协议。Argo协议是基于区块链技术构建的,它没有中心化的服务器架构。相反,它是由一组相互连接的节点组成的网络。每个节点都有完整的区块链副本,并且可以参与到网络的共识算法中。
Argo的分散式结构有以下几个原因:
-
安全性:由于Argo没有中心化的服务器,网络上的数据会被分散存储在所有的节点中。这意味着没有单一的服务器成为攻击者的目标,降低了攻击的风险。同时,Argo的分散式共识算法能够防止篡改和伪造数据的风险。
-
可靠性:Argo的分散式结构意味着即使有些节点出现故障或离线,其他节点仍然可以继续运行,确保网络的可靠性和稳定性。因此,即使有部分节点发生故障,整个网络也不会中断。
-
去中心化的特点:Argo的目标是实现去中心化的网络,使得权力和控制分散在所有参与者之间。没有中心化的服务器,意味着没有单一实体能够控制网络的运行。这种去中心化的特点可以保护用户的隐私,并防止数据被滥用。
总之,Argo没有服务器是因为它采用了分散式的网络结构,这样可以提高系统的安全性、可靠性,并实现去中心化的目标。
1年前 -
-
Argo是一种服务器开发的框架,旨在提供一种快速和简单的方式来构建高效的服务器应用程序。然而,Argo本身并不是一个服务器,而是一个框架或工具,帮助开发者构建服务器应用程序。以下是解释为什么Argo本身没有服务器。
-
框架的设计目标:Argo的设计目标是提供一种简单而灵活的方式来构建服务器应用程序,而不是提供一个完整的服务器实现。它提供了一套API和工具来处理HTTP请求和响应,但不提供底层服务器的实现。这样可以让开发者有更大的自由度来选择和配置底层服务器,以满足他们的具体需求。
-
跨平台支持:Argo是一个跨平台的框架,可以在不同的操作系统和环境中使用。如果Argo直接提供一个服务器实现,那么就需要为每个特定的操作系统和环境提供不同的服务器实现,这将增加开发和维护的复杂性。
-
多种服务器选择:Argo鼓励开发者使用自己喜欢和熟悉的服务器,而不是强制使用特定的服务器实现。这使得开发者可以根据自己的需求和喜好选择合适的服务器,例如Nginx、Apache、Tomcat等。这样也便于Argo与不同的服务器协同工作,而不局限于单一的服务器实现。
-
解耦和可扩展性:通过将Argo与特定的服务器解耦,开发者可以方便地将Argo集成到现有的基础设施中,无论是传统的单服务器架构还是现代的云环境。此外,Argo还支持插件和扩展来增强其功能。
-
社区与生态系统:由于Argo没有自己的服务器实现,它可以与各种服务器和工具集成,并受到广大开发者社区的支持。这使得Argo能够从丰富的社区和生态系统中获得支持、贡献和扩展。加入Argo的生态系统,可以将其用于各种不同的服务器架构和应用场景中。
总之,Argo之所以没有服务器实现是基于其设计目标、跨平台支持、多种服务器选择、解耦和可扩展性,以及与社区和生态系统的紧密合作。这使得开发者可以根据自己的需求和偏好选择适合的服务器,并将Argo集成到他们的应用程序中,以构建高效的服务器应用程序。
1年前 -
-
Argo没有服务器的原因是它是一种去中心化的网络协议和平台。去中心化是指没有集中的服务器或中心机构来控制和管理整个系统。相反,Argo是通过使用区块链技术和分布式账本来实现网络和数据的存储、传输和管理。
在传统的网络架构中,通常需要服务器来承担存储、处理和传输数据的功能。服务器扮演着中央节点的角色,用户需要通过服务器来进行数据交换和互通。这种架构存在一些问题,比如单点故障、安全风险和依赖中心服务器等。
而Argo利用区块链技术和分布式账本,消除了中心服务器的需求。它使用了一种称为“P2P”(peer-to-peer,点对点)的网络架构,所有参与网络的节点都可以充当客户端和服务器。这意味着每个节点都可以存储、传输和处理数据,而不需要依赖中心服务器。
具体来说,Argo的去中心化网络架构包括以下几个关键组件:
-
区块链:Argo使用了自己的区块链来存储数据和交易记录。所有参与网络的节点都可以下载和复制这个区块链,并使用密码学算法来验证和添加新的数据块。这保证了数据的安全性和完整性。
-
分布式账本:Argo的分布式账本是一种共享账本,所有的节点都可以读取和写入数据。每个节点都有一个副本,当有新的数据写入时,它会被广播到整个网络中的其他节点。通过共享账本,所有的节点都可以获得相同的数据,而不需要通过中心服务器。
-
P2P网络:Argo使用了P2P网络来连接所有的节点。每个节点都可以直接与其他节点通信,进行数据交换和传输。这样的网络结构消除了单点故障的风险,并提高了网络的可扩展性和鲁棒性。
通过以上的去中心化设计,Argo能够实现高效、安全和可持续的数据存储和传输。没有中心服务器的存在,意味着Argo不受任何集权机构的控制和干扰,用户可以更加自主地管理和控制自己的数据。同时,Argo的去中心化也带来了一些挑战,比如网络效率、数据一致性和节点管理等问题,但通过持续的技术创新和社区的共同努力,这些挑战也将得到解决。
1年前 -